Men's Basketball Drops OVC Opener 77-75 to Southern Indiana

EVANSVILLE, IND. —Brandon Weston totaled 33 points and Aaron Nkrumah added 20, but the Tennessee State men's basketball team fell to the Southern Indiana Screaming Eagles 77-75 on the road Thursday.

The Tigers (4-8, 0-1) had two players score in double figures, led by Weston, who had 33 points and eight rebounds. Nkrumah added 20 points, seven rebounds, five assists and two steals and Josh Ogundele added nine points and eight rebounds.

Led by Weston's three offensive rebounds, Tennessee State did a great job crashing the offensive glass, pulling down 13 boards that resulted in 13 second chance points.

The Tennessee State defense held Southern Indiana shooters to only 40 percent from the field. The Screaming Eagles did not get many second opportunities on the offensive end, as they grabbed only eight offensive rebounds and scored nine second chance points while Tennessee State pulled down 31 defensive rebounds.

How It Happened

After falling behind 32-27, Tennessee State went on a 7-0 run with 4:47 left in the first half to take a 34-32 lead. The Tigers then lost some of that lead, but still entered halftime with a 40-39 advantage. Tennessee State capitalized on eight Southern Indiana turnovers in the period, turning them into 12 points on the other end of the floor.

Southern Indiana proceeded to take a 61-56 lead before Tennessee State went on a 9-0 run, finished off by Nkrumah's jumper, to seize a 65-61 lead with 5:47 to go in the contest. Southern Indiana re-asserted control, outscoring the Tigers 16-10 the rest of the way to hand Tennessee State the 77-75 loss. Tennessee State shot well from three-point range in the half, hitting five shots from deep to score 15 of its 35 points.
